Is Patek 5712 discontinued?
A-001 has been silently discontinued. As of early 2025, the quintessential steel Nautilus complication, a collector favorite for nearly two decades, is no longer in production. The Patek 5712 discontinued news, which follows the legendary retirement of the 5711, has sent shockwaves through the watch world. Patek Philippe 5712/1A Discontinued: What it Means for Collectors? With the discontinuation of the Nautilus 5712 Steel, the value of this model is expected to skyrocket in the secondary market. It was already a desirable model and used to exchange hands for a premium over its retail price.Discontinued in 2021, the 5711 now sells for more than 3x retail on the secondary market.
